IRDAI, NHA form joint working group on Ayushman Bharat

Bid to improve implementation of health insurance scheme

  • A joint working group (JWG) comprising senior officials from IRDAI and National Health Authority (NHA) has been formed to recommend measures to help improve the implementation of the Centre’s Ayushman Bharat Pradhan Mantri Jan Arogya Yojana (AB-PMJAY) or the health insurance scheme for the poor.
  • The 11-member group, with NHA Deputy CEO Dinesh Arora as the chair and lRDAl Executive Director Suresh Mathur as the co-chair, would submit a report on various aspects pertaining to network hospitals’ management; data standardisation and exchange; fraud abuse and control; and common IT infrastructure for health insurance claims management.
  • The JWG would define hospital infrastructure and facility audits to understand capacity of hospitals as well as specialists availability and chalk out a roadmap for one common list of accredited verified hospitals for the entire industry.
  • Under the fraud and abuse control component, the JWG would make recommendations in six months to help detect and deter frauds through a common repository and capacity-building.
